<p>➀ The US Chips Act is under threat after President Trump's speech in Congress; </p><p>➁ Trump urged Congress to scrap the Act and use leftover funds for other purposes; </p><p>➂ Trump believes tariffs are a better way to support domestic chip-making and cited TSMC's $100 billion investment in Arizona fabs as an example.</p>
